A quick definition of successive:

Successive: When things or people come one after the other in a row, it is called successive. For example, if you have three classes in a row, they are successive classes.

A more thorough explanation:

Definition: Following in order; consecutive.

Example 1: The team won three successive games in a row.

Example 2: The company's CEO retired and was replaced by two successive CEOs.

These examples illustrate the definition of successive by showing that the events or people mentioned occurred one after the other in a specific order. The first example shows that the team won three games in a row, meaning they won one game, then another, and then another. The second example shows that the CEO retired and was replaced by two other CEOs, one after the other. This means that the first CEO left, then the second CEO took over, and then the third CEO took over after the second one.
